FOUNDATION FOR A STRONG MAINE ECONOMY, of AUGUSTA, ME, is a Public Charity tracked in Imperigo's IRS 990 database. The 2024 filing shows $3.6M in revenue, $3.3M in expenses, $2.2M in total assets. 25 publicly reported grants to this organization, totaling roughly $1.0M, appear in IRS filings.

Financial Trends

Year Revenue Expenses Assets
2024 $3.6M $3.3M $2.2M
2023 $3.2M $3.5M $2.2M
2022 $2.2M $2.3M $5.2M
2021 $2.5M $2.3M $1.6M
2020 $2.8M $2.6M $1.6M

Between 2020 and 2024, reported annual revenue grew from $2.8M to $3.6M (+28%), with total assets most recently reported at $2.2M.
